use reqwest::Method;
use serde::{Deserialize, Serialize};
use crate::core::{
api_req::ApiRequest,
api_resp::{ApiResponseTrait, BaseResponse, ResponseFormat},
config::Config,
constants::AccessTokenType,
endpoints::{cloud_docs::*, EndpointBuilder},
http::Transport,
req_option::RequestOption,
SDKResult,
};
use super::batch_create::Permission;
#[derive(Debug, Serialize, Default, Clone)]
pub struct UpdatePermissionMemberRequest {
#[serde(skip)]
api_request: ApiRequest,
#[serde(skip)]
token: String,
#[serde(skip)]
obj_type: String,
#[serde(skip)]
member_type: String,
#[serde(skip)]
member_id: String,
perm: Permission,
#[serde(skip_serializing_if = "Option::is_none")]
need_notification: Option<bool>,
}
impl UpdatePermissionMemberRequest {
pub fn builder() -> UpdatePermissionMemberRequestBuilder {
UpdatePermissionMemberRequestBuilder::default()
}
pub fn new(
token: impl ToString,
obj_type: impl ToString,
member_type: impl ToString,
member_id: impl ToString,
permission: Permission,
) -> Self {
Self {
token: token.to_string(),
obj_type: obj_type.to_string(),
member_type: member_type.to_string(),
member_id: member_id.to_string(),
perm: permission,
..Default::default()
}
}
pub fn for_user(
token: impl ToString,
obj_type: impl ToString,
user_id: impl ToString,
permission: Permission,
) -> Self {
Self::new(token, obj_type, "user", user_id, permission)
}
pub fn for_chat(
token: impl ToString,
obj_type: impl ToString,
chat_id: impl ToString,
permission: Permission,
) -> Self {
Self::new(token, obj_type, "chat", chat_id, permission)
}
pub fn for_department(
token: impl ToString,
obj_type: impl ToString,
department_id: impl ToString,
permission: Permission,
) -> Self {
Self::new(token, obj_type, "department", department_id, permission)
}
}
#[derive(Default)]
pub struct UpdatePermissionMemberRequestBuilder {
request: UpdatePermissionMemberRequest,
}
impl UpdatePermissionMemberRequestBuilder {
pub fn token(mut self, token: impl ToString) -> Self {
self.request.token = token.to_string();
self
}
pub fn obj_type(mut self, obj_type: impl ToString) -> Self {
self.request.obj_type = obj_type.to_string();
self
}
pub fn as_doc(mut self) -> Self {
self.request.obj_type = "doc".to_string();
self
}
pub fn as_sheet(mut self) -> Self {
self.request.obj_type = "sheet".to_string();
self
}
pub fn as_bitable(mut self) -> Self {
self.request.obj_type = "bitable".to_string();
self
}
pub fn as_wiki(mut self) -> Self {
self.request.obj_type = "wiki".to_string();
self
}
pub fn member(mut self, member_type: impl ToString, member_id: impl ToString) -> Self {
self.request.member_type = member_type.to_string();
self.request.member_id = member_id.to_string();
self
}
pub fn user(mut self, user_id: impl ToString) -> Self {
self.request.member_type = "user".to_string();
self.request.member_id = user_id.to_string();
self
}
pub fn chat(mut self, chat_id: impl ToString) -> Self {
self.request.member_type = "chat".to_string();
self.request.member_id = chat_id.to_string();
self
}
pub fn department(mut self, department_id: impl ToString) -> Self {
self.request.member_type = "department".to_string();
self.request.member_id = department_id.to_string();
self
}
pub fn permission(mut self, permission: Permission) -> Self {
self.request.perm = permission;
self
}
pub fn to_owner(mut self) -> Self {
self.request.perm = Permission::FullAccess;
self
}
pub fn to_editor(mut self) -> Self {
self.request.perm = Permission::Edit;
self
}
pub fn to_commenter(mut self) -> Self {
self.request.perm = Permission::Comment;
self
}
pub fn to_viewer(mut self) -> Self {
self.request.perm = Permission::View;
self
}
pub fn need_notification(mut self, need: bool) -> Self {
self.request.need_notification = Some(need);
self
}
pub fn with_notification(mut self) -> Self {
self.request.need_notification = Some(true);
self
}
pub fn without_notification(mut self) -> Self {
self.request.need_notification = Some(false);
self
}
pub fn build(mut self) -> UpdatePermissionMemberRequest {
self.request.api_request.body = serde_json::to_vec(&self.request).unwrap();
self.request
}
}
#[derive(Debug, Deserialize)]
pub struct PermissionMemberUpdated {
pub member_type: String,
pub member_id: String,
pub perm: Permission,
pub update_time: Option<i64>,
pub old_perm: Option<Permission>,
pub notified: Option<bool>,
}
#[derive(Debug, Deserialize)]
pub struct UpdatePermissionMemberResponse {
pub member: PermissionMemberUpdated,
}
impl ApiResponseTrait for UpdatePermissionMemberResponse {
fn data_format() -> ResponseFormat {
ResponseFormat::Data
}
}
pub async fn update_permission_member(
request: UpdatePermissionMemberRequest,
config: &Config,
option: Option<RequestOption>,
) -> SDKResult<BaseResponse<UpdatePermissionMemberResponse>> {
let mut api_req = request.api_request;
api_req.http_method = Method::PUT;
api_req.api_path = format!(
"{}?type={}&member_type={}",
EndpointBuilder::replace_params_from_array(
DRIVE_V1_PERMISSIONS_MEMBER_GET,
&[("token", &request.token), ("member_id", &request.member_id)]
),
request.obj_type,
request.member_type
);
if let Some(need_notification) = request.need_notification {
api_req.api_path = format!(
"{}&need_notification={}",
api_req.api_path, need_notification
);
}
api_req.supported_access_token_types = vec![AccessTokenType::Tenant, AccessTokenType::User];
let api_resp = Transport::request(api_req, config, option).await?;
Ok(api_resp)
}
